The owner has a real attitude problem and is so rude. I took a co worker there who is from Thailand and was wanting to show off the restaurant as one of the best Thai places in Dallas. I've gone over the years many times. My friend can't have sugar and tried to order her dish without sugar. It came out to her and was very sweet with sugar. Then the owner refused to re make it. From other reviews I've read, lots of their menu is too sweet and they won't tailor it because they pre make all their sauces! At the prices they charge, $18-22 per dish, they should be able to tailor their sauces especially since they advertise " gluten free, vegetarian dishes etc. " My dish however was so hot neither of us could eat it. It was probably a 7 star out of the normal 1-4 star range. Un edible! I had ordered a 3 star. My friend tried to tell the owner in Thai that it was so hot with spice it burned both of our throats but the owner argued with us and refused to help amend it with coconut milk, which was my Thai friends solution. I took it home to try to fix it from home and it just continually got hotter as it fermented. I didn't want to throw it away as it wasn't a cheap meal. Gave them another chance a few months later. Not only was my dish now $22.00, they charge another $1.85 for a tiny tablespoon of sauce. When I mentioned it, the owner said she could take it out of the waitresses paycheck. She said this in front of other customers too. The poor waitress looked abused. They are getting too expensive for the quality and service they provide. There are a ton of other Thai places in Dallas.
